MAT-1 Battery Replacement Tool Kit, Rev A 1
MAT-1 Battery Replacement Tool Kit
The MAT-1 Battery Replacement Tool Kit
contains the items that are required to
replace the battery in a MAT-1 Data
Lo er. The kit also includes one
replacement battery to et you started.
Additional batteries may be purchased
separately.
Package Contents
• Circuit Board Holdin Tool
• 3/32” Hex Driver
• Replacement “A” size lithium battery
Caution: This logger is sensitive to static electricity when removed from the logger housing. old the
circuit board by the edges and avoid working on indoor carpet or in other static prone environments.
Instructions
1. Remove the end cap of the lo er, connect a USB cable and use MAT Lo er Commander to
stop the lo er. Failure to stop a runnin lo er will result in data loss.
2. Slide the Circuit Board Holdin Tool into the end of the lo er. Ali nin the slot in the tool with
the circuit board.
3. Locate the two hex screws inside the lo er and insert the hex driver into one of them.
4. Loosen, but do not remove the screw. Repeat on the other side.
5. The board should now be loose within the housin . Gently tap the housin and slide the circuit
board and battery out of the lo er.

MAT-1 Battery Replacement Tool Kit, Rev A 2
6. Disconnect the old battery by ently pullin on the battery leads.
7. Inspect the desiccant. Replace or refresh the
desiccant if not bri ht blue. To refresh desiccant,
warm it with an electric toaster oven or hot plate
at 100 C (210 F) for 20-30 minutes.
8. The lo er must completely power down for a
clean restart. Wait at least 3 minutes between
disconnectin the old battery and reconnectin the
new battery for the on-board capacitors to
dischar e.
9. Connect the new battery by ently pushin the
polarized connector into the battery socket. Verify that the reen and red LED’s flash three
times. If not, disconnect the battery, wait 3 minutes and repeat.
10. Carefully slide the battery, circuit board holder, desiccant and circuit board back into the lo er
housin . It may take a couple of attempts to et the han of it. Do not use force. Gently push
the board all the way into the housin usin the Circuit Board Holdin Tool.
11. Use the hex driver to ti hten the hex screws. Alternate sides and do not over torque. (Use four
fin ers, not your whole arm!)
12. Reconnect the USB cable, open the Lo er Status window in MAT Lo er Commander and open
the COM port.

MAT-1 Battery Replacement Tool Kit, Rev A 3
13. Verify that the “Lo er Time” has reset to the year 2000, that the battery status is “Good” and
that the “Real-time Data” is updatin . If any of them are not true, then the lo er was not fully
reset and the lo er must be power-cycled a ain. Go back to step 2 and increase the time
between disconnectin and reconnectin the battery.
14. You are done! Reset the lo er’s clock and continue usin your MAT-1 Data Lo er.

Warning: This logger contains a lithium battery. Do not cut open, incinerate, heat above 85°C (185°F), or
recharge the lithium battery. The battery may explode if the logger is exposed to extreme heat or
conditions that could damage or destroy the battery case. Do not dispose of loggers or batteries in fire.
Do not expose the contents of the batteries to water. Dispose of the batteries according to local
regulations for lithium batteries.
